Stanford … WebWelcome to the Peripheral Neural Engineering and Urodynamics Lab (pNEURO Lab). Dr. Tim Bruns is is the Principal Investigator and is a newly tenured Associate Professor in the Department of Biomedical Engineering. The lab is part of the Biointerfaces Institute at the North Campus Research Complex.

Web4 Department of Chemical & Environmental Engineering, Yale Univer-sity, New Haven, CT 06511, USA 5 Department of Physiology, Yale University, New Haven, CT 06511, USA … WebBME 200: Introduction to Biomedical Engineering Biomedical Engineering. Introduction to the basic scientific and engineering concepts of biomedical engineering and its connection with the full spectrum of human activity. Introduction to biomolecular engineering, biomedical systems engineering, and bioinformatics.
